mt76: mt7615: introduce PM support



Introduce suspend/resume to mt7615e driver

int mt7615_wait_pdma_busy(struct mt7615_dev *dev)
{
	struct mt76_dev *mdev = &dev->mt76;

	if (!is_mt7663(mdev)) {
		u32 mask = MT_PDMA_TX_BUSY | MT_PDMA_RX_BUSY;
		u32 reg = mt7615_reg_map(dev, MT_PDMA_BUSY);

		if (!mt76_poll_msec(dev, reg, mask, 0, 1000)) {
			dev_err(mdev->dev, "PDMA engine busy\n");
			return -EIO;
		}

		return 0;
	}

	if (!mt76_poll_msec(dev, MT_PDMA_BUSY_STATUS,
			    MT_PDMA_TX_IDX_BUSY, 0, 1000)) {
		dev_err(mdev->dev, "PDMA engine tx busy\n");
		return -EIO;
	}

	if (!mt76_poll_msec(dev, MT_PSE_PG_INFO,
			    MT_PSE_SRC_CNT, 0, 1000)) {
		dev_err(mdev->dev, "PSE engine busy\n");
		return -EIO;
	}

	if (!mt76_poll_msec(dev, MT_PDMA_BUSY_STATUS,
			    MT_PDMA_BUSY_IDX, 0, 1000)) {
		dev_err(mdev->dev, "PDMA engine busy\n");
		return -EIO;
	}

	return 0;
}
